After My Death (2018)

My close friend is dead, and people swam around me for answers.

After My Death (2018) poster

When a school girl disappears, suicide is suspected, and one of her classmates is suspected of having goaded her into it.

Director: Kim Ui-seok
Genre: Drama, Mystery
Runtime: 113 min
